Oldacre Surname Meaning

From Where Does The Surname Originate? meaning and history

(English) Dweller at the Old Field [Old English e)ald, old + œcer, a field]

Surnames of the United Kingdom (1912) by Henry Harrison

Local: "the old acre," i.e. field.

Patronymica Britannica (1860) by Mark Antony Lower

From Aldecar; a location name in Derbyshire.

British Family Names: Their Origin and Meaning (1903) by Henry Barber

How Common Is The Last Name Oldacre? popularity and diffusion

The surname Oldacre is the 449,013th most widespread family name on earth. It is borne by around 1 in 9,614,177 people. This last name occurs predominantly in The Americas, where 51 percent of Oldacre live; 32 percent live in North America and 31 percent live in Anglo-North America.

The last name Oldacre is most commonly used in The United States, where it is held by 267 people, or 1 in 1,357,524. In The United States it is primarily found in: Florida, where 19 percent are found, New York, where 18 percent are found and Alabama, where 17 percent are found. Aside from The United States Oldacre is found in 12 countries. It is also found in England, where 26 percent are found and Jamaica, where 20 percent are found.

Oldacre Family Population Trend historical fluctuation

The incidence of Oldacre has changed through the years. In The United States the share of the population with the last name increased 411 percent between 1880 and 2014 and in England it increased 107 percent between 1881 and 2014.
